This is the first edition of our popular Perl 5 book after the release of Perl 6, a language that started its life as something based on Perl but has now taken on a life of its own. Unfortunately, that bit of history means both languages have “Perl” in the name even though they are only lightly related. It’s likely that you want Perl 5 and this book unless you know that you don’t. And, from this point, “Perl” means Perl 5, the same Perl that’s been getting work done for a couple of decades.
